Are you passionate about supporting people and creating positive workplace experiences? We’re looking for a People & Culture Advisor to join our People & Culture team at Blue Cross on a 6 month fixed term basis.

This is a varied and rewarding role where you’ll work closely with managers and colleagues across the organisation, providing practical advice, guidance and support on a wide range of people matters, while helping us continue to build an inclusive and collaborative One Blue Cross culture.

More about the role

Are you an experienced HR professional with a strong background in Employee Relations? We're looking for a People & Culture Advisor to join our People & Culture team at Blue Cross on a 6 month fixed term contract.

This is a varied and rewarding role where you'll work closely with managers and colleagues across the organisation, providing practical advice, guidance and support on a wide range of people matters. A key focus of the role will be supporting managers through Employee Relations matters, helping them navigate both informal and formal processes confidently and consistently.

We're looking for someone who can quickly build effective relationships, work independently and confidently manage a varied caseload, making this an excellent opportunity for an experienced HR professional looking to make an immediate impact.

About you

You'll be an experienced HR professional with strong Employee Relations knowledge and the confidence to advise managers through a wide range of people matters. You'll be comfortable handling both informal and formal cases and able to provide practical, balanced advice that supports positive outcomes while ensuring compliance with policy and employment legislation.

You'll have excellent communication and relationship-building skills, enabling you to influence, challenge and support managers effectively. You'll be highly organised, able to manage multiple priorities and comfortable working independently while collaborating as part of a wider team.
Most importantly, you'll be someone who enjoys helping managers navigate complex people issues and is able to quickly establish credibility and trust within a busy operational environment.

Essential Qualifications, Skills, and Experience

  • Previous experience of working in HR, gained throughout the employee life cycle 
  • Significant experience of advising and coaching managers through formal and informal Employee Relations cases, including sickness absence, grievance, disciplinary and capability matters
  • Experience of advising managers through formal and informal Employee Relations cases including sickness absence, grievance, disciplinary and capability
  • Confident in dealing with numbers and experience of analysing and reporting data 
  • Excellent interpersonal skills and customer-facing skills 
  • Strong communication skills, both written and verbal 
  • Good attention to detail 
  • Great administration skills 
  • A proven track record of prioritising and organising work and projects within a busy and multi-functioning role 
  • IT literate with MS Office, web-based platforms, and databases 
  • The ability to demonstrate, understand and apply our Blue Cross values

Desirable Qualifications, Skills, and Experience

  • CIPD Level 3 
  • Experience of working with volunteers in a HR environment 
  • Experience of managing projects and development programmes 
  • An understanding of the demands of the voluntary sector
